Do you wonder which states in the U.S. are the best for naturopathic physicians? If so, we have the full list of best to worst states for naturopathic physician jobs for you to check out and see if you think it's time to move and start anew. Not all states fare the same when it come to job opportunity and pay.Our research found that North Dakota is the best state for naturopathic physicians, while California and Louisiana are ranked highest in terms of median salary. North Dakota has a median salary of $159,661 and California has the highest median salary among all 50 states for naturopathic physicians.
To do that, we looked at the most recent data we have available for the following criteria -- average annual wages, and availability of jobs for naturopathic physicians.We found that the West is best for naturopathic physicians, and the Northeast is the worst. San Diego, CA is the best city in the country for naturopathic physician jobs, where as North Dakota is the best state in the country.
